I received a Hobby set and a Retail set today. Both were in their own distinctive paper packets.

Both sets are of 27 cards with 25 of the 27 being exactly alike these being cards 2-26, Cards 1 and 27 show on the reverse either Hobby Set Ltd Ed or Retail Set Ltd Ed, in addition the picture on card 1 for the Hooby set is a "landscape" view of the Titanic leaving the slipway whereas the corresponding card in the retail set is a close-up of the ship in "portrait" view.

The Retail set also contained a TP1 card, Titanic Artifact Card TA1 containing a piece of coal and Titanic chase card TCC with a Canadian Titanic 1912-2012 Postage Stamp.

The Hobby Set contained TP1, TP2, TP3, Titanic Artifact Card TA1 containing a piece of cotton, a canvas puzzle card 3/9 (this being part of the picture used on promo BP1).

I also found in the packaging a case card from the Hobby Box this being a canvas complete picture of the puzzle card sub-set.

I too received a retail and hobby set today.

As well as the base set my retail set included Titanic Photo chase card - TP1, Canvas 7 of 9 and a 'Reproduction' mini card. I was disappointed with the chase hits and having seen John's break above (two premium hits) i'm even more so!

My hobby set included TP 1, 2 and 3, RMS Olympic card RMS-O and Titanic Artifact card TA1 featuring red thread seat fabric.

No idea whether this is good, bad or indifferent as a checklist and card quantities are a complete mystery.
